* When tracking the critical path, if not keeping incremental state, don't ↵Gravatar janakr2017-04-06
keep references to actions indefinitely. Instead, once an action is finished executing, keep just some metadata about it. This allows actions to be unconditionally dropped when running with --batch, --discard_analysis_cache, and --keep_going, even if profiling is enabled. The additional fields here add between 8 and 12 bytes per component, and we have one component per action. This additional penalty is only incurred when we are already saving memory, so I think it's ok. The full penalty will be realized only towards the end of the build, when every action has started executing at least once. Users can still specify --noexperimental_enable_critical_path_profiling if they want to squeeze even more memory out. PiperOrigin-RevId: 152328870
